Police Arrest Four Suspects for Burning Old Woman to Death
Four suspects have been arrested by the Anambra State Police, Abagana Division, in connection with the burning to death of a 74-year-old woman in a wheelchair in Abagana.

The suspects are 21-year-old Chinenye Ekwenugo from Ifitedunu, 47-year-old Uzochukwu Okeke, 60-year-old Fidel Anayo, and 54-year-old Ikenna Anene, all from Abagana. They were apprehended on Sunday, January 26, 2025, at 9 a.m.
Police operatives recovered the charred remains of the deceased, her wheelchair, and a casket. According to SP Tochukwu Ikenga, the Public Relations Officer of the Command, Chinenye confessed that her boyfriend, Ifeanyi Igwe, who is currently at large, along with three others, set the victim on fire and procured a casket to bury her before the intervention of security forces.

Authorities are also actively working to apprehend Ifeanyi Igwe, the main suspect, who remains in hiding. The body of the deceased has been taken to the morgue for an autopsy and further investigation into the cause of death.
In response to the incident, Commissioner of Police Nnaghe Obono Itam urged the public to remain calm and ordered the immediate transfer of the case to the Homicide Section of the State Criminal Investigation Department for a thorough investigation.
